ABOUT KHAN ACADEMY

Khan Academy is a nonprofit with the mission to deliver a free, world-class education to anyone, anywhere. Our proven learning platform offers free, high-quality supplemental learning content and practice that cover Pre-K – 12th grade and early college core academic subjects, focusing on math and science. We have over 155 million registered learners globally and are committed to improving learning outcomes for students worldwide, focusing on learners in historically under-resourced communities.

THE ROLE

Works as part of the People Operations Team to provide full cycle talent acquisition and HR operations support. This role will be responsible for such duties as supporting the recruitment process by crafting job descriptions, preparing job offer letters, conducting compensation analyses, maintaining candidate databases, coordinating interviews, and assisting with onboarding. Additionally, you will:

  • Provide support throughout the various hiring phases, including candidate attraction, resume screening, interview scheduling, and hiring communication management.
  • Schedule interviews; oversee preparation of interview guides, toolkits, and other hiring and selection materials.
  • Collaborate with hiring managers to identify and draft detailed and accurate job descriptions and hiring criteria.
  • Facilitate hiring managers through the appropriate hiring process gaining required approvals.
  • Provide coordination and administrative support for HR initiatives and projects.
  • Support implementation, upgrades, or changes to HRIS platforms.
  • Coordinate, monitor and audit information entered into HRIS platforms.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ve internal stakeholder HRIS issues.
  • Respond to external and internal general inquiries and requests.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
